  • JOHN Swinney was mocked by rivals for complaining about the polarisation of Scottish politics - despite admitting he’s contributed to it.
    The newly-appointed SNP leader has been on the frontbenches at Holyrood for the majority of the time his party has been in power since 2007.
    And he has been involved in several angry exchanges with opposition MSPs, including last week when he lost his cool with Scottish Tory leader Douglas Ross for making a jibe about his “honest John” nickname.
    However, in a speech accepting the leadership of the SNP in Glasgow - having stood unopposed for the job - he vowed to adopt a different approach, as he suggested nothing can be achieved by “shouting at people”.
